Well, it's time for a new computer, and I have just about everything figured out except for the case. This is going to be my first non-budget friendly build, and I'm attempting my first custom water loop (first computer with any water cooled component actually) so it has to be perfect. Originally I was going to Lian Li PC-011 (this was back around October) but the price premium and the slightly more exotic look turned me away. Lian Li then announced the Alpha series cases that looked cool, and I figured you'd get the Lian Li build quality for around 150? Sounds like a deal to me. Unfortunately case reviews looked rather poor. Then comes the Fractal Design R6. I was determined this was going to be my case until about a week ago. The only way you can mount a 360mm rad up top and in the front, is with the front rad having the ports on the top, which makes poor loop draining, so this probably won't happen. I have a list of features I'd like to see, so I'm hoping someone can tell me what the name of this case is, as I know pretty much what I want:
-I'd like a mid tower case
-Has to accommodate 2 360mm radiators
-Dust filters are pretty much a must so no case labs cases
-I've grown to like the look of PSU shrouds that are in cases. Hides more cables for a cleaner look
-Tempered glass side panel to show off my loop, but the other side I'd prefer not to be tg. The top and front can be whatever.
-Good cable management features (gromets and tie downs on the back. This is why I'm not going with the EVGA DG series)
I feel like I'll get a few recommendations for the NZXT s340, and I know it checks pretty much everything off the list (not sure about the rad room in it), the one and only silly reason I don't want this case is that I've seen a lot of builds in this case, both online and with my buddies, and it doesn't seem very special to me anymore.
